The Pucci beach caftan is one of those iconic vintage items that is synonymous with the 1960s and that carefree, jet set life that Emilio Pucci and his clients often lived. Variations of this example were heavily featured in the display at the Fondazione Emilio Pucci, Palaxxo Pucci, in Florence. There, they were displayed and encased under glass so that you could see then from every angle and each felt like a sculpture. They are very rare and hard to find as most were worn them extensively and most did not survive intact and in great condition. The piece is made of a terry cloth, toweling velvet and is a stunning example of this classic piece of Pucci's work during this time period. It has no sleeves and is meant to be worn layered over something else, whether that be a bikini, shorts, another dress or a skirt. The possibilities are endless.It has a geometric print in a gorgeous ocean theme that combines green, purple, a turquoise aqua, black and white. It completely unzips and opens at the side along one seam that I have photoed. This makes it extremely versatile and allows it to slip over just about anything or be worn as a stand alone. The front neckline sits on a V and the sides are open right to the waist. The print is vivid and bright and it one of his signature designs. The fabric is also signed throughout. These are hard to come by and a fantastic collector piece. Excellent condition with one small note to review below.

The body of the dress is unlined but it does have a fine cotton muslin interior border in a aqua blue hand stitched in place around all the edges. It closes with a hand placed metal zipper at the side that completely opens the dress. There is also a row of fabric covered, hand places snaps along the seam of one shoulder.
